    Abstract: Compressing files is disclosed. An input file to be compressed is first aligned. During or prior to aligning the input file, hyperparameters are set, determined, or configured. The hyperparameters may be set, determined, or configured to achieve a particular performance characteristic. Aligning the file includes splitting the file into sequences that can be aligned. The result is a compression matrix, where each row of the matrix corresponds to part of the file. A consensus sequence id determined from the compression matrix. Using the consensus sequence, pointer pairs are generated. Each pointer pair identifies a subsequence of the consensus matrix. The compressed file includes the pointer pairs and the consensus sequence.

    Abstract: Systems and methods are directed to a compression scheme for stable universally unique identities in a collaborative editing environment. A client receives edits to a document and immediately creates a local short identity for an element of each edit, whereby the local short identity represents an offset from a base unique identity associated with the client from which a unique identifier assigned to the element is derivable. The local short identity information including the local short identity for each element is transmitted to a server. Subsequently, global short identity information is received from the server from which one or more global short identities that each map to a local short identity of a client of a plurality of clients collaborating on the document can be determined by the client. Each global short identity is a compact identity that is universally unique to the plurality of clients including the client.

    Abstract: A method for providing one or more random sample documents from a corpus of documents using a search engine is provided. The providing of each of the random sample documents comprises selecting randomly a time window from a set of time windows. A search query is sent to the search engine defining a search for documents of the corpus with time-stamps within the time window defined by the randomly selected time window. In response to the sending of the search query, a search result is receiving from the search engine. The search result comprises a set of the documents of the corpus with time-stamps within the time window. One of the documents comprised by the received set of documents is then selected randomly.

    Abstract: Embodiments described herein are directed to generating a tree-based data structure representative of a data set and the verification thereof. As each data item of a data set is updated, a leaf node is generated that stores a hash value therefor. For every even leaf node generated, a parent node storing a hash value based on the hash values of its child nodes is generated. For each level of the tree, the hash value of the last odd node generated therefor is maintained. The foregoing process is performed recursively at each level of the tree. During verification, a new root hash value is determined for a new tree-based data structure generated for the data set to be verified. The old and new root hash values are compared. If the hash values do not match, a remediation is performed to restore the data set.
